WebOct 3, 2024 · Five games into his 14th NFL season, Bob Griese, father to then-6-year-old Brian, suffered a shoulder injury. It was severe enough to end his 1980 season and his Hall of Fame career at 35 years old. WebGriese was born in Evansville, Indiana to Ida (Ulrich) and Sylverious "Slick" Griese. Slick owned a plumbing company in Evansville and died in 1955 when Bob was ten years old. Bob played baseball primarily, and excelled as a pitcher. He also starred in basketball and football at Evansville's Rex Mundi High School. WebBob Griese is pictured with his late wife Judi and their three sons (left to right) Brian, Jeff and Scott near their home in Coral Gables. All three Griese sons went on to become football standouts at Miami's Columbus High School. Judi Griese passed away from breast cancer in 1988 at the age of 44. WebOct 18, 2024 · For his career, Griese was an excellent 92-56-3 and managed games with the best of them. However, he still had a 5% interception rate, a career 77.1 quarterback rating, and completed just 56% of his passes. If you’re curious how demanding Griese’s job was, just note that he had 25,092 yards over 14 seasons. WebBob Griese, a two-time All-America at Purdue, was the Dolphins' No. 1 draft choice in their second year in 1967. He enjoyed an excellent rookie season with 2,005 yards and 15 touchdowns passing and, for the remainder of his Hall of Fame career, he was the poised leader of a classic ball-control offense that generated an awesomely efficient ...
